Visa Requirements for Japan Tour Packages from Delhi:
Obtaining a tourist VISA is the first requirement before embarking on your vacation with our Japan travel package. The Japan tourist visa can be applied for online or through the Japanese Embassy, but it only allows for single admissions. The visa application process typically takes a few days, and its validity can extend up to thirty days. It is advisable to be informed about revisions in visa requirements, laws, and limitations in order to ensure a hassle-free journey to Japan.
Indian citizens for Delhi to Japan package usually have to pay between INR 5,000 and INR 6,000 for a visa to enter Japan. Depending on things like the type of visa and processing fees, this price could change. Making sure all necessary paperwork is in place is essential to a seamless visa application procedure.

How to Get Delhi To Japan: There are two main routes from India to Japan. One option is to go directly from major cities like Delhi and Bangalore to Japan's Tokyo-Haneda or Narita airports. Airlines like Japan Airlines and All Nippon Airways are available for travel. These flights take seven or eight hours, and they are speedier.
Alternatively, you might book a ticket with a layover. This means that before arriving in Japan, your airline makes a stop at another city. You can take flights to Tokyo-Haneda or Narita from cities like Mumbai, New Delhi, and Bangalore, with stops in locations like Colombo, Kuala Lumpur, Hong Kong, and Ahmedabad. These flights are provided by airlines such as Thai Airways, Cathay Pacific, Vistara Airways, and VietJet Air. They take longer, about 10 to 16 hours

1. Tokyo Tower: Constructed in 1958, Tokyo Tower is a well-known Japanese landmark. It boasts two viewing decks offering a breathtaking 360-degree panorama of the city. Its height is 333 metres, or 1092 feet. Made of red and white latticed steel, this structure is modelled after the Eiffel structure. The Tokyo Tower should not be missed from your Japan travel packages because it houses a restaurant, an aquarium, a Shinto shrine, a museum, and several other leisure areas.
Address: 4 Chome-2-8 Shibakoen, Tokyo 105-0011, Minato City, Japan
Main observation desk hours are from 9 a.m. to 11 p.m.
Desk for special observation: 9 a.m. to 10 p.m.

5. Fushimi Inari-Taisha: This significant Shinto shrine is renowned for its crimson torii gates and is situated in southern Kyoto. A system of pathways that leads to the holy Mount Inari woodland is located behind the main building.
Location: 68 Fukakusa Yabunouchicho, Fushimi Ward, Kyoto, 612-0882, Japan
Timings: Open 24 hours
The sixth is the Gekkeikan Okura Sake Museum. The name Sake translates to "alcohol" in Japanese, and the museum is housed in a 1909 brewery. It gives a history of the Fushimi and the equipment and materials employed, particularly by the 1637-founded Gekkeikan sake brewery.
Location: 247 Minamihamacho, Fushimi Ward, Kyoto, 612-8043, Japan
Timings: 9:30 a.m. to 4:30 p.m.
7. Kiyomizu-Dera: Kiyomizudera, which translates to "Pure Water Temple," is one of Japan's most well-known and renowned temples. Known for its wooden platform, this temple dates back to its founding in 780. At the foot of the Kiyomizu-Dera great hall sits the Otowa waterfall. In 1994, it was included on the list of UNESCO World Heritage Sites. The colourful and captivating perspective of Kyoto city and the cherry and maple trees below is offered by the wooden stage.
